Your Initial Chiropractic Appointment
The initial visit comprises a comprehensive health evaluation. It’s designed to identify your concerns and tailor a care plan. This foundational session kick-starts your complementary health journey.
During the consultation, your chiropractor will conduct a thorough evaluation. It covers:
- Comprehensive medical history intake
- Comprehensive physical examination
- Potential diagnostic tests
- Discussion of treatment goals
Reviewing your history is essential. Your chiropractor will inquire about past injuries, current pain, lifestyle factors, and health conditions. This helps them understand your physical well-being fully.
Possible assessments include:
- Spinal alignment assessments
- Range of motion tests
- Neurological screenings
- Radiographs or advanced imaging
Post-assessment, you’ll review treatment options. These could involve adjustments, adjunct therapies, and bespoke wellness plans.

Chiropractic Education Pathway
Becoming a chiropractor requires substantial academic and practical preparation:
- A four-year doctoral graduate curriculum
- At least 4,200 hours of combined classroom, lab, and clinical study
- Curriculum comparable to medical and osteopathic schools
- In-depth learning in anatomy, physiology, and diagnostics

Professional Standards and Licensing
Strict professional standards ensure the quality and safety of chiropractic care. Chiropractors are required to:
- Complete national board examinations
- Obtain state-specific licensing
- Participate in continuing education
- Adhere to ethical guidelines

Assessing Chiropractic Safety and Risks
Chiropractic care is a valuable healthcare approach, but understanding its safety profile is key for patients. Most treatments are safe, but knowing the risks helps you make informed health decisions.
Evaluating spinal adjustment safety involves multiple considerations. Properly trained chiropractors reduce complication likelihood. This expertise safeguards patient well-being.
When Chiropractic Isn’t Advisable
Chiropractic may not suit every individual. Certain conditions may prevent you from receiving spinal manipulation:
- Advanced osteoporosis
- Inflammatory arthritis
- Cord impingement
- Spinal malignancies
- Existing fractures
Understanding Side Effects
Most patients experience minimal side effects from spinal manipulation. Common side effects include:
- Short-lived soreness
- Transient headaches
- Slight fatigue
- Short-term pain flare before relief
When to Seek Alternative Treatment
If you experience persistent pain or unusual symptoms after spinal manipulation, consult your healthcare provider. Some warning signs include:
- Intense or persistent discomfort
- Ongoing numbness or paresthesia
- Radiating pain in extremities
- Continued motion limitation
Always communicate openly with your chiropractor about your medical history and any concerns. This ensures safe and effective spinal manipulation.
